Output f621052e9e5b6907bcd2b19a2383ea42401f0da8dbb8bed8ba9091e1ad0120ad:0

value
1039756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5169908072b78cbf10dc4f97d695ce1ac51427f0 OP_EQUALVERIFY OP_CHECKSIG
address
18RUCHZX8GEQSnAZYDvu43dDWddERqfQTg
transaction
f621052e9e5b6907bcd2b19a2383ea42401f0da8dbb8bed8ba9091e1ad0120ad
spent
true